Suarez and Bale are two different type of players - both world class and both offer something different

Bales pace is his main asset - he glides past people and finishes smartly - his dead ball deliver is top quality.

Suarez is more skilful , more creative and has more all round ability. As players then I would pick Suarez every day if the choice was between the two. Suarez has more strings to his bow

Postby devaney » Fri Aug 02, 2013 11:53 am

only me - What do you mean you don't like Luis? Come on he is a win at all costs street fighter and learned how to play in one of the poorest areas in Uruguay.He is no angel but he is entertainment personified. His character has got him to the top of his sport.To suggest that he is toxic to our name is an absolute exaggeration that the press would like everybody to believe. Embarrassing at times. Toxic never.

Yes he has a frustrating selfish streak and wastes opportunities but it still difficult to criticise somebody that has scored 51 goals in 96 games. The selfish bit is also partly as a result of Liverpool's relatively new contract policy to incentivise players for achievement. Luis's performance is mainly measured by the number of goals he scores.The more he scores the more he earns.When he hit a certain number of goals last season his weekly wage went up from £80k to £120k.
